Practical Notes for Brand Designers
Before integrating the Christmas Dogs Sublimation Bundle into your projects, consider these technical and creative checks:
- Color Palette Testing: Ensure the colors in the bundle complement your existing brand palette. If your brand uses cool tones, verify that the warm reds and greens in the Christmas theme do not clash.
- Typography Pairing: Test the illustrations with different font styles. They pair beautifully with handwritten fonts for a personal touch, but also work well with sans serif fonts for modern clarity. Avoid pairing them with overly ornate display fonts that create visual clutter.
- Scalability Check: Preview the assets on mobile screens. Small details in complex illustrations can become muddy when scaled down for mobile ads or thumbnails. Always check readability in small sizes.
- Black and White Usage: Convert the images to grayscale to ensure the shapes hold up without color. This is vital for printable design options like black-and-white flyers or embossed packaging.
- Licensing Verification: Most importantly, confirm the commercial license. Ensure you have the right to use these digital products in paid campaigns, client work, and merchandise sales. This protects your business from legal issues and maintains professional integrity.
